Unexpected displacement of clipped/masked objects due to layer transforms
Bug #569281 reported by
Jeff Fortin Tam
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Inkscape |
Fix Released
|
Medium
|
Mc |
Bug Description
Short version/executive summary:
1. create two layers, one with a shape that will be used for a mask, and another below for the rectangle filled with a color or gradient
2. change the document properties (canvas size) in a significant way (Ex: 30% more height)
3. inkscape silently adds transformation attributes to the layers instead of moving the objects
4. result: when you create a new layer or object later on, and try to apply it to the mask created in step #1, it messes up
See the attached video for a demonstration.
Related branches
summary: |
- layer translation attributes on canvas resize mess things up later on + Unexpected displacement of clipped/masked objects due to layer + transforms |
Changed in inkscape: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
reproduced with Inkscape 0.47+devel r9366 on OS X 10.5.8
same unexpected 'translate' of the clipped or masked object if clipping/masking path and clipped/masked object are in differently transformed layers (happens when adding a layer after resizing the page or changing the page format/ orientation) .